A Sky Park Above the City
The festival takes place every October at Haneul Park, also known as Sky Park, located in the World Cup Park area of Mapo-gu, Seoul.
This park was once a landfill, but it has been reborn into one of Seoul’s most beautiful eco-spaces — a symbol of transformation and hope.
When the silver grass (Eulalia or Pampas Grass) blooms, the hill becomes covered in tall, shimmering waves that sway with the wind like the ocean under moonlight.
In 2025, the Seoul Silver Grass Festival is expected to run from October 10 to October 20, filling the park with light, art, and music.

What to Expect
As the sun sets over the Han River, the entire hill glows silver — and that’s when the magic begins.
- 🌾 Silver Grass Fields: Walk through glowing paths surrounded by endless silver waves.
- 💡 Light Installations: Beautiful night illuminations create a dreamy, romantic atmosphere.
- 📸 Photo Zones: Perfect spots for capturing the beauty of autumn in Seoul.
- 🎶 Live Performances: Soft music, acoustic bands, and cultural shows add a warm vibe to the evening.
- ☕ Local Cafés & Food Stalls: Cozy pop-up cafés offering seasonal treats and hot drinks.
It’s one of the most romantic autumn experiences in South Korea — ideal for couples, photographers, or anyone seeking peace above the city noise.
